Freedom of information

Although some confusion has arisen around the FOIA, service users and carers should be assured that their personal information is not available through the FOIA, and that nobody can successfully obtain access to their Health and Social Care Records using an FOI request.

Service users wishing to view their own Health and Social Care Records can do so by making a Subject Access Request under the Data Protection Act 1998. Ask your care co-ordinator for further information or visit our Confidentiality page.
